Transaction

40f0ac389cdeb62ffc5dfac1c531c960e68ca2d11c0e70b0f4e14401a5e14493
77,016 confirmations
Timestamp
1727590796
Block863,312
Fee4,179 sats
Fee rate8.08 sats/vB
view on mempool.space

Inputs & Outputs